Apple has launched a new Instagram account over the weekend, which happened to coincide with one of the most anticipated script releases this year: Harry Potter and the Cursed Child.

The @iBooks account mostly consists of quotes from books and authors – which is awesome if you’re one of those Instagrammers who live and die by inspirational sayings (we all have one of those friends on our feeds.) iBooks tease both upcoming and new releases, alongside miniature book reviews and generic promotional shots of people reading. Each book is advertised in a series of three Instagram posts.

You can tell that Apple’s truly caught the Harry Potter fever though: both its iTunes and iBooks account feature profile links to the Cursed Child script download page and videos honoring author J.K. Rowling’s birthday.
